New Zealand Context & Institutional Expectations

New Zealand does not issue commercial online casino licences to private offshore operators. However, gambling policy and harm minimisation frameworks are actively governed by national institutions. Offshore operators serving NZ players are indirectly evaluated against those public standards.

Authoritative institutional bodies shaping gambling policy in New Zealand include:

These organisations do not license Yukon Gold Casino. However, they define the broader player protection expectations influencing public perception.
